MOHANDAS K. GANDHI
An excellent vintage signed 4.75 in. x 5.75 photograph of Gandhi in a head and shoulders pose outdoors, with his familiar white robe draped over his shoulders, looking slightly downwards as he signs autographs on the occasion of his birthday at Pune on 2nd October 1944. Photograph by Kanu Gandhi and signed by him in black ink on the verso, also adding 'Copy Right' in his hand. S.P., signed twice by Gandhi in blue fountain pen ink to a light area at the base of the image, firstly in Gujarati and a second time ('M. K. Gandhi') in Roman script. Lightly hinged at the upper edge of the verso to an oblong folio page removed from an album. An exceptionally fine signed image. Kanu Gandhi (1917-1986) Indian photographer, was a grandnephew of Mahatma Gandhi who lived with him in several of his ashrams and was a member of his personal staff. Gandhi allowed Kanu to photograph him on three conditions: that he use no flash, that he never be asked to pose, and that his photography would not be funded by the Ashram. A slightly larger example of the same image exists in which three other individuals can be seen, two of them identified as Rajkumari Amrit Kaur and Sohoraben (an ashramite). Provenance: From an album which was previously part of a private autograph collection assembled by an antiquarian bookseller in Prague during the 1960s.
